- Step into the ring of nostalgia as we take a powerbomb down memory lane to revisit the iconic year of 1995 in professional wrestling. This was a year where the WWE (then WWF) and WCW went head-to-head in an epic showdown for supremacy, bringing forth some of the most memorable moments in sports entertainment.
1995 was a year marked by intense rivalries, stunning upsets, and the rise of future legends. In the WWE, we witnessed the ascension of superstars like Shawn Michaels, Bret 'The Hitman' Hart, Diesel, and The Undertaker, each delivering unforgettable matches and moments. Michaels' show-stealing performances, Hart's technical prowess, Diesel's dominating championship run, and The Undertaker's dark and mysterious persona captivated fans worldwide.
Meanwhile, WCW was making waves with its own roster of incredible talent. The year saw the likes of Sting, Ric Flair, Hulk Hogan, and Randy Savage dominate the scene. Hogan's iconic turn and the intense Flair vs. Savage feud were just a few highlights that defined WCW's narrative in 1995.
This video dives deep into the key events, matches, and storylines that shaped 1995 in pro wrestling. We explore the groundbreaking pay-per-views, like WrestleMania XI, SummerSlam, Survivor Series, WCW's Bash at the Beach, and Halloween Havoc. Each event contributed significantly to the landscape of professional wrestling as we know it today.
